Understanding the Raypak Pool Heater SW Open Code

Before diving into the solutions, it’s crucial to understand what the SW Open code actually means. SW Open stands for “Switch Open.” This code is displayed when the heater’s control board detects an open circuit in one of the safety switches. These switches are designed to prevent the heater from operating if certain conditions are not met, ensuring the safety of your pool and equipment.

Common Causes of the SW Open Code

  1. Faulty Pressure Switch: The pressure switch is a critical safety component in your Raypak pool heater. It ensures that there is adequate water flow through the heater before allowing it to ignite. If the pressure switch malfunctions or becomes clogged with debris, it can trigger the SW Open code.
  2. Flue Temperature Sensor Issues: The flue temperature sensor monitors the temperature of the exhaust gases. If it detects excessive heat, it will shut down the heater to prevent overheating. A faulty flue temperature sensor can cause the SW Open code to appear.
  3. Air Flow Problems: Proper air flow is essential for the heater’s operation. If the heater detects insufficient air flow or blockages in the combustion air intake or exhaust vents, it may trigger the SW Open code as a safety measure.
  4. Clogged Heat Exchanger: Over time, minerals and debris can accumulate in the heat exchanger, reducing water flow and heat transfer efficiency. This can lead to overheating and trigger the SW Open code.

Effective Fixes for the SW Open Code

  1. Inspect and Clean the Pressure Switch: Start by checking the pressure switch for debris or blockages. Remove any obstructions and ensure it’s properly connected. If it’s damaged or malfunctioning, replace it with a compatible pressure switch.
  2. Check the Flue Temperature Sensor: Inspect the flue temperature sensor for loose connections or damage. If necessary, replace the sensor with a new one that matches the specifications of your Raypak pool heater.
  3. Ensure Proper Air Flow: Clear any obstructions from the combustion air intake and exhaust vents. Make sure there are no nearby objects blocking airflow to the heater. Additionally, check the blower fan for proper operation.
  4. Clean the Heat Exchanger: If you suspect a clogged heat exchanger, it’s essential to clean it thoroughly.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for safe cleaning practices. Regular maintenance can prevent this issue from recurring.
  5. Professional Service: If you’ve tried the above steps and still encounter the SW Open code, it’s advisable to contact a professional pool heater technician. They have the expertise and specialized tools to diagnose and repair complex issues.

Preventive Maintenance Tips

Apart from troubleshooting and fixing the SW Open code, it’s essential to establish a regular maintenance routine for your Raypak pool heater to prevent future issues. Here are some preventive maintenance tips to keep your heater in top condition:

  1. Regularly Clean the Filter: A clean filter ensures proper water flow, which is crucial for your heater’s operation. Clean or replace your pool’s filter as recommended by the manufacturer.
  2. Monitor Water Chemistry: Maintaining the right water chemistry is not only essential for your pool but also for your heater. Imbalanced water chemistry can lead to scale buildup in the heat exchanger, reducing its efficiency. Test your pool water regularly and adjust chemicals as needed.
  3. Inspect Burner and Ignition System: Check the burner and ignition system for any signs of corrosion, damage, or soot buildup. Clean or replace any components that show wear and tear.
  4. Clean and Inspect Venting: Ensure that the venting system is clear of debris and properly connected. Blocked vents can cause the SW Open code to appear.
  5. Schedule Professional Maintenance: Consider scheduling annual or biannual maintenance with a qualified technician. They can perform a comprehensive inspection, clean critical components, and address any potential issues before they become major problems.
  6. Keep the Area Around the Heater Clear: Make sure there are no flammable materials or clutter near the heater. Adequate ventilation around the unit is essential for safety.
  7. Invest in a Pool Heater Cover: If your pool heater is exposed to the elements, consider investing in a cover. A cover can protect the unit from weather-related damage and extend its lifespan.

By following these preventive maintenance tips and promptly addressing any issues like the SW Open code, you can ensure that your Raypak pool heater continues to provide reliable and efficient heating for your pool, allowing you to enjoy comfortable swimming experiences year-round.

What does it mean when my pool heater says water sw open? ›

For issues regarding "LO" [Hayward], "Check Flow" [Jandy] or "Water SW Open" [Raypack/Rheem] displayed on the heater, the issue can likely be traced back to a waterflow issue as opposed to a heater issue. The result of poor flow is the heater will not turn on (this is by design), leading to cold water.

What is the SW code on a Raypak heater? ›

The sw water error is telling you the flow of water through the heater is not sufficient to start the heater. This is typically due to a dirty filter. If a sand filter backwash. If a cartridge or de filter remove and clean.

What does open water sensor mean on pool heater? ›

(open water temp sensor) That means the control board can no longer read the temperature of the incoming water. It is a common issue. Solution is first check wiring connection of sensor at the control board, but most likely sensor is defective and needs to be replaced.

Why is my pool heater not detecting water? ›

Your heater may have inadequate water flow due to a dirty filter, closed valve, external bypass, reversed water connections, or pressure switch out of adjustment. It is also possible that your thermostat is out of calibration or needs to be replaced.

Why does my pool heater say no water flow? ›

The most common reason for low or no flow is that the baskets are full of debris. By checking and emptying both the skimmer basket (by the pool) and the pump basket (inside the pump) will free up the water flow, allowing the system to fully 'prime' and function at full capacity.
